The multiple criteria group decision-making problem involves a set of feasible alternatives that are evaluated on the basis of multiple, conflicting and noncommensurate criteria by a group of individuals. This paper is concerned with developing a GIS-based approach to group decision-making under multiple criteria. The approach integrates, within a raster GIS environment, the Technique for Order Preference by Similarity to Ideal Solution (TOPSIS) and Borda`s choice rule. TOPSIS orders the feasible alternatives according to their closeness to the ideal solution. It is used to derive the individual preference orderings. Borda`s method combines the individual preferences into a group preference or consensus/compromise ranking. The approach is implemented within the IDRISI GIS and illustrated on a hypothetical decision situation.
